Course Details

Introduction to Smart Energy Integration: Understanding the fundamentals of smart energy integration, its importance, and benefits.
Emerging Trends in Smart Energy: Exploring the latest trends and advancements in smart energy, including renewable energy sources, energy storage, and smart grids.
Smart Grid Technology: Examining the technology and infrastructure behind smart grids, including communication networks, automation, and control systems.
Energy Storage Solutions: Delving into the various energy storage technologies, such as batteries, flywheels, and pumped hydro storage, and their role in smart energy integration.
Renewable Energy Integration: Discussing the challenges and solutions associated with integrating ren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ind, into the smart grid.
Energy Management Systems: Examining the role of energy management systems in smart energy integration and their impact on energy efficiency and demand response.
Policy and Regulation for Smart Energy: Understanding the policy and regulatory frameworks that govern smart energy integration, including standards, certifications, and incentives.
Cybersecurity in Smart Energy: Exploring the cybersecurity risks and challenges associated with smart energy integration and the best practices to mitigate them.
Business Models for Smart Energy: Examining the various business models that are being adopted in the smart energy industry, such as energy service companies, energy-as-a-service, and power purchase agreements.

Career Path

The Smart Energy Integration sector is gaining traction in the UK, with a growing demand for professionals skilled in renewable energy, smart grids, and energy storage. In this section, we present an interactive 3D pie chart that illustrates the most sought-after roles and their market shares in the industry, providing valuable insights for those considering an Executive Development Programme in this field. Let's take a closer look at the top five roles in the Smart Energy Integration sector: 1. **Smart Energy Engineer**: With a 30% share, these professionals are responsible for designing, installing, and maintaining smart energy systems, ensuring efficient energy use and integration with existing infrastructure. 2. **Renewable Energy Consultant**: Holding a 25% share, consultants in this field help businesses and individuals make informed decisions about renewable energy solutions, assessing the feasibility and potential benefits of various options. 3. **Energy Storage Specialist**: With a 20% share, energy storage specialists focus on managing and optimizing energy storage technologies to ensure a reliable and resilient energy supply, as well as reducing energy costs. 4. **Smart Grid Analyst**: Claiming a 15% share, smart grid analysts monitor and analyze data from smart grids to identify trends, optimize grid performance, and detect potential issues before they become critical. 5. **Energy Trading Expert**: Energy trading experts, with a 10% share, are responsible for buying and selling energy on wholesale markets, utilizing their knowledge of market trends, supply and demand, and regulatory requirements.
